A guy I bowled with in college built something using PVC.  A support was in each gutter and a long piece connected the two.  We then hung a piece of fabric over your target.  The benefit of this over what the Turbo video is showing that if you missed, you didn't have to walk back down the lane and reset everything.  And I can imagine hitting several boards off and sending one of the cones flying onto someone else's lane.
